Our Home Needs Your Help
Our home in Cebu was devastated by Typhoon Tino. San Isidro is a barangay (village) in Talisay City on the island of Cebu, in the Central Philippines.

In just 24 hours, the storm unleashed a month’s worth of rain, taking 114 lives and leaving thousands without shelter. Our barangay, San Isidro in Talisay, where most of our friends and family still live, experienced significant destruction. More than 1,000 people are currently displaced—without homes, food, clean water, or basic necessities. Many areas in San Isidro remain without electricity and families are staying in temporary shelters or with neighbors as they wait for assistance. Roads are flooded or blocked by debris, making it difficult to deliver relief to some parts of the community.

Our immediate family—our siblings, aunts, uncles, cousins, and relatives—are safe. But our neighbors and community need urgent help.

Our family told us how residents had to climb to the safety of their roofs as floodwaters rose, watching their homes—and their lives—swept away by the typhoon. Despite losing so much, everyone is working together to rebuild and recover, sharing food, shelter, hope, and gratitude.
